What Are Skill-Based Slot Machines?

Skill-based slot machines differ from traditional slots in that they allow players to influence the outcome through their actions or decisions. While luck still plays a significant role in these games, players are given the opportunity to apply skill to improve their chances of winning. In some games, this might involve solving puzzles, hitting targets, or completing mini-games. The idea is to make the gameplay more interactive and engaging, providing players with more control over their success.

These games often combine elements of classic slot mechanics with interactive features, offering a hybrid experience that appeals to players who enjoy both the randomness of traditional slots and the challenge of skill-based gameplay. With skill-based slots, players are rewarded for their actions, making the game feel less like a pure gamble and more like an opportunity for active participation.

What Are Bitcoin Casinos?

  1. Understanding Bitcoin Casinos

A Bitcoin casino is an online casino that accepts Bitcoin (and sometimes other cryptocurrencies) as the primary method for transactions. Players can use Bitcoin to fund their accounts, place bets, and withdraw their winnings. These casinos typically operate in much the same way as traditional online casinos, offering various casino games such as slots, blackjack, roulette, and poker. The key difference is that Bitcoin transactions replace conventional payment methods like credit cards or e-wallets.

The advantages of using Bitcoin in casinos are becoming increasingly clear: faster transactions, lower fees, and enhanced privacy. Players can deposit funds instantly and withdraw their winnings without waiting for several days for traditional banking systems to process the transaction.

  1. How Bitcoin Works in Online Gambling

In a Bitcoin casino, players first create an account and deposit Bitcoin into their digital wallet. They then use this balance to place bets and play games. When they win, the winnings are transferred back into their Bitcoin wallet, which can be easily converted into fiat currency or used for other transactions.

Bitcoin casinos often utilize the blockchain technology behind Bitcoin, which provides added security and transparency to all transactions. This allows players to verify that the games are fair and that the winnings are paid out without interference from third parties.

What Are Social Casinos?

Social casinos are online gaming platforms that allow players to enjoy traditional casino games, such as slots, poker, and blackjack, without the need to wager real money. Instead of cash, players use virtual currencies or “coins” to place bets, which means they can enjoy the thrill of the game without the financial risk. While the games may mimic traditional casino games in terms of mechanics and graphics, the key difference is that there are no real-world financial transactions involved.

These platforms often incorporate social elements, allowing players to interact with each other, join tournaments, or share their successes on social media. This combination of gaming and social interaction creates a unique and engaging experience, which explains why social casinos are so popular among younger gamblers.

1. What Does a Croupier Actually Do? (Spoiler: It’s Not Just Dealing Cards)

If you think a croupier’s job is just flipping cards and spinning the roulette wheel, think again. A croupier (or dealer) is responsible for running table games in a casino, ensuring that the game flows smoothly, dealing cards or managing chips, and enforcing the rules. But it doesn’t stop there—croupiers also need to interact with players, handle large sums of money, and keep an eye out for anyone trying to cheat.

You’ll need to know your games inside out—whether it’s blackjack, poker, or roulette—and be able to manage the table with precision and confidence. You’re not just part of the game; you’re the one in control of it.

2. The Skills You Need to Be a Top-Notch Croupier

Working as a croupier is about more than just learning the rules of the games—it’s a full-on skill set. Here’s what you’ll need to be successful:

  • Math Skills: You don’t need to be a math genius, but quick mental arithmetic is a must. You’ll need to calculate payouts, handle chips, and manage bets—all in real-time.
  • People Skills: A big part of the job is interacting with players, and your ability to engage with them, be friendly, and diffuse tension when things get heated is key.
  • Attention to Detail: With so much money changing hands, you need to stay focused and ensure that the game runs fairly and smoothly.
  • Dexterity and Speed: Whether you’re shuffling cards or managing chips, being fast and smooth is critical. The game needs to flow, and you need to make sure it does.

If you’ve got these skills (or are ready to build them), you’re well on your way to croupier success.

3. Training: How to Get Your Croupier Game On Point

You can’t just walk into a casino and start dealing cards. Training is essential to becoming a croupier, and many casinos offer in-house training programs where you’ll learn the ins and outs of the games. These programs typically last a few weeks, and they’ll teach you everything from the rules of each game to handling bets, managing players, and mastering the smooth shuffling of cards.

You can also find specialized croupier schools that offer more extensive training, teaching advanced techniques and preparing you for all types of table games. Either way, you’ll need to ace your training before you can land a job dealing at a real casino.

Key Indicators of a Reliable Live Casino Platform

1. Licensing and Regulation

One of the most critical aspects to check is whether the live casino is licensed and regulated by reputable authorities. Licensing bodies such as the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), the United Kingdom Gambling Commission (UKGC), and the Gibraltar Regulatory Authority ensure that casinos adhere to strict standards of fairness, security, and responsible gaming. A valid license is a clear indicator that the platform operates legally and ethically.

2. Secure and Encrypted Transactions

Reliable live casinos prioritize the security of their players’ financial information. Look for platforms that use advanced encryption technologies, such as SSL (Secure Socket Layer), to protect your data during transactions. Additionally, reputable casinos offer a variety of secure payment methods, including credit/debit cards, e-wallets like PayPal and Skrill, and even cryptocurrencies for added privacy and security.

3. Fair Play and RNG Certification

Ensuring fair play is paramount in any casino setting. Reliable live casinos employ Random Number Generators (RNGs) to guarantee that game outcomes are random and unbiased. Independent auditing agencies like eCOGRA, iTech Labs, and GLI regularly test and certify RNGs, providing players with confidence that the games are fair and transparent.

4. Transparent Terms and Conditions

A trustworthy live casino platform provides clear and comprehensive terms and conditions. These should cover aspects such as wagering requirements, withdrawal limits, bonus terms, and privacy policies. Transparent policies help prevent misunderstandings and ensure that you know exactly what to expect when playing and withdrawing your winnings.
